The purpose of this study was to examine the effect of cognitive behavioral coping skills procedures on an African American male, with a history of alcohol consumption on a daily basis, diagnosed with end stage renal disease. A single system research design was used. It was found that a 12 week session of cognitive behavioral coping skills reduced the alcohol consumption of the client.

Food-for-Work (FFW) was conceived as both a short-run assistance program for meeting basic food needs of low income households, and as a long-run developmental tool for building infrastructure and for providing income to ease capital constraints on farm production. However, it was feared that FFW might divert labor from own-farm production and reduce the level of locally produced food crops. The purpose of this dissertation was to empirically examine these hypotheses in the Ewalel and Marigat locations of Baringo District, Rift Valley Province, Kenya.
